The D.A.S. utilizes a large inlet to guide cool ambient air from the front grill directly into your intake system. This design, alongside the high-performance aFe POWER Pro DRY S drop-in filter, boosts your vehicle's performance and sharpens throttle response, allowing you to fully unlock your vehicle's potential. This D.A.S. PLUS is constructed from high-quality linear low-density polyethylene (LLDPE) that is impact resistant, extremely durable, and 100% recyclable. This filter features three layers of oil-free synthetic media and requires no oil during maintenance to provide maximum convenience. Its progressive layering provides great filtration efficiency and dust holding capacity. This media is best suited for street use. Pro DRY S filters are easily recharged with aFe's POWER CLEANER.
